Allyl 4-[({(2S,4R)-1-{(2E)-3-[5-chloro-2-(1H-tetrazol-1-yl)phenyl]-2-propenoyl}-4-[1-(methylsulfonyl)-4-piperidinyl]-2-pyrrolidinyl}carbonyl)amino]benzoate was prepared by following the procedures described in Examples 5, 9 and 8 starting from the compound prepared in Example 63. (Note: in the step corresponding to Example 5, allyl 4-aminobenzoate was used in place of tert-butyl 4-aminobenzoate. In the step corresponding to Example 8, (2E)-3-[5-chloro-2-(1H-tetrazol-1-yl)phenyl]acrylic acid was used in place of 1-(N,N′-bis(tert-butoxycarbonyl)carbamimidoyl)piperidine-4-carboxylic acid). After that, to a solution of the crude allyl ester (48 mg) in N,N-dimethylformamide (1 mL) was added tetrakis(triphenylphosphine)palladium(0) (2 mg) and 1,3-dimethylbarbituric acid (4 mg) and the reaction stirred overnight at room temperature. Further tetrakis(triphenylphosphine)palladium(0) (3 mg) was added at this juncture and stirring continued at room temperature for 7 h. The reaction mixture was left to stand overnight, diluted with a 1:1 mixture of diisopropylether and dichloromethane (1 mL) and the resulting precipitate collected by filtration. The yellow powder obtained was washed with dichloromethane and dried to give the title compound having the following physical properties (25 mg).
